From: | "Pepe Ballaga" <pepe(at)transnet(dot)cu> |
---|---|
To: | <pgsql-es-ayuda(at)postgresql(dot)org> |
Subject: | Fw: problemas con Pervasive, Btrieve y webservice en .Net |
Date: | 2005-06-01 14:51:40 |
Message-ID: | 012f01c566b9$6b7156e0$da64000a@pepesql |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Amigos tengo un problema bastante raro con lo siguiente: tengo un web
service que lo hago de la siguiente manera y funciona correctamente (me
devuelve el XML perfectamente) e inclusive la instruccion resultante que
esta en cadena desde el enterprise de Btrive funciona bien:
<WebMethod()> Public Function productoslike(ByVal nombre As String) As
DataSet
Dim myreader As New Data.DataSet
Dim cadena As String = "SELECT ltrim(rtrim(artbst.artcode))as artcode FROM
artbst where artbst.oms30_0 LIKE " & " " & "'%" & "" & UCase(Trim(nombre))
&
"%'" & " "
Dim adapter3 As System.Data.Odbc.OdbcDataAdapter
adapter3 = New Odbc.OdbcDataAdapter(cadena,
"DecimalSymbol=.;ArrayBufferSize=8;ClientVersion=8.60.192.030;DSN=serviciotienda;OpenMode=-1;DBQ=SERVICIOTIENDA;ArrayFetchOn=1;AutoDoubleQuote=0;CodePageConvert=1252") adapter3.Fill(myreader) Return myreader el problema es que cuando llamo a este servicio desde la aplicacion web,me da este error y tal parece un problema de ODBC, pero de veras que no tengo idea de como solucionarlo. Asi llamo al servicio: Dim tabla1 As System.Data.DataSet tabla1 = servicio.productoslike(nombre) Este es el error que da cuando lo llama (en realidad cuando corre la aplicacion el error ocurre en el fill del webservice. Server was unable to process request. --> ERROR [42000] [Pervasive][ODBC Client Interface][LNA][Pervasive][ODBC Engine Interface]Syntax Error:SELECT ltrim(rtrim(artbst.artcode))as artcode FROM artbst where artbst.oms30_0LIKE '%'TUB<< ??? >>'%' ¿alguna idea de como solucionar esto?. Tambien probé con OLDB y me da error tambien. Muchas gracias Cualquier ayuda se agradec!
e. Disculpen el mensaje tan largo. PEPE Pepe BallagaAnalista de SistemasSITRANS. La Habana CubaTel: 8624685 pepe(dot)ballaga(at)gmail(dot)com
From | Date | Subject | |
---|---|---|---|
Next Message | Mauricio Zea (Gmail) | 2005-06-01 14:59:46 | Re: Fw: imagenes en la DB |
Previous Message | Alvaro Herrera | 2005-06-01 14:49:34 | Re: Recoleccion de Estadisticas |